flagpoles的音標是["fl?ɡp??lz],基本翻譯是旗桿。速記技巧可以是將其拆分為 flag(旗)、pole(桿)幾個關鍵詞,便于記憶。
Flagpoles這個詞的詞源可以追溯到古英語,它由詞根“flag”和“pole”組成。其中,“flag”意為旗幟,“pole”意為桿子。這個詞的意思就是“旗桿”。
變化形式:復數形式是flagpoles。
